在数字化时代,爬虫技术作为一种高效的数据获取手段,被广泛应用于互联网信息的采集、分析和处理。然而,随着爬虫技术的普及,其逆向风险也逐渐凸显,尤其是在法律和安全边界方面。本文将深入解析爬虫逆向风险,探讨相关法律红线和安全边界。
一、爬虫逆向风险概述
1.1 爬虫技术简介
爬虫,即网络爬虫,是一种自动化程序,通过模拟浏览器行为,自动获取网页内容。它广泛应用于搜索引擎、数据挖掘、舆情监测等领域。
1.2 爬虫逆向风险
爬虫逆向风险主要表现在以下几个方面:
- 数据泄露风险:爬虫在获取数据过程中,可能无意中泄露用户隐私、商业机密等敏感信息。
- 法律风险:未经授权爬取他人网站数据,可能侵犯他人知识产权、隐私权等。
- 安全风险:爬虫程序可能被恶意利用,攻击目标网站,导致网站瘫痪。
二、法律红线解析
2.1 知识产权保护
根据《中华人民共和国著作权法》等法律法规,未经授权爬取他人网站数据,可能侵犯他人著作权、商标权等知识产权。
2.2 隐私权保护
根据《中华人民共和国个人信息保护法》等法律法规,爬虫在获取数据过程中,必须遵守隐私保护原则,不得非法收集、使用、加工、传输个人信息。
2.3 网络安全法
根据《中华人民共和国网络安全法》,爬虫程序不得用于实施网络攻击、破坏网络安全等违法行为。
三、安全边界探讨
3.1 数据获取边界
爬虫在获取数据时,应遵循以下原则:
- 合法合规:确保数据获取行为符合相关法律法规。
- 尊重网站规则:遵守目标网站的反爬虫策略,避免对网站造成过大压力。
- 数据用途明确:明确数据用途,确保数据获取行为符合道德伦理。
3.2 技术安全边界
爬虫程序开发过程中,应关注以下安全边界:
- 代码安全:确保代码质量,避免代码漏洞被恶意利用。
- 数据安全:对获取的数据进行加密、脱敏等处理,防止数据泄露。
- 访问控制:对爬虫程序进行访问控制,防止未授权访问。
四、案例分析
以下是一些爬虫逆向风险案例:
- 案例一:某公司未经授权爬取某知名电商平台数据,导致数据泄露,涉及用户隐私、商业机密等敏感信息。
- 案例二:某爬虫程序被恶意利用,攻击某知名网站,导致网站瘫痪,造成严重经济损失。
五、总结
爬虫技术在互联网时代发挥着重要作用,但同时也存在逆向风险。了解法律红线和安全边界,对爬虫开发者而言至关重要。本文旨在帮助读者深入了解爬虫逆向风险,提高数据安全意识,共同维护网络空间安全。
